aim to point something at a thing that you want to hit.
clue something that helps to solve a problem or mystery.
corner the place where two roads meet.
dusk the time of day just before night; last moments of twilight.
island an area of land surrounded by water on all sides.
leadership ability or skill as a leader.
lemon a small, sour fruit with yellow skin. Lemons grow on trees.
mask a covering that hides all or part of the face.
money the coins or paper bills of a country that are used to buy things or pay for services.
movement a motion or way of moving.
park an area of public land that anyone can use for rest and enjoyment.
rich having a great amount of money or valuable possessions.
spool an object shaped like a cylinder with a rim on each end. Thread, tape, wire, and film are wound on spools.
tall of more than average height.
wing a part of the body of some animals that they use for flying. Insects and birds have wings.
